SHIPPING OUTLOOK. SIB A. G. ANDERSON ON TRADE IMPROVEMENT.

In his presidential address to the manual meeting of the Chamber of Shipping at the Lethersellers Hall, St. Helensplace, E.C., Sir Alan G. Anderson make this fol lowing points:~~

12

The depression is with us still. But we have touched the bottom of had feights. There still is a redundant Nect of vessels in all countries ready at short notice to put a when freights ris and, by floud- ing the market, to bring about an amodi- ate lapse

of freights. The tonnage land up in the United Kingdon has fallen fron 1,300,000 tolls grow in January 1992 10 1.008.000 tons grows in January There is evidence that the position of the British Mercantile Marine is improving,

The late Government started lending

to shipowners or shipbuilder ey, to easy terms to bring about employment in the shipbuilding cares. It is dangerou to apply this artificial stimulant to the ship. building trade in its

present condition. If shipbuilles and owners are left to work out their own salvation according to veun- anie laws the orders for ships, will gradu. ally in hip built before its time by Giov ecument notion will probably postpone i dozen or mere other, orders which woul! otherwise have been placed.

THE PERIL

The success of our oversea trade is graves ly imperilled by the present methods of settling wages in British industry. We have left behind us settlement by sectional strike and we have not reached settlemei: by reason. We hope that the Labour Gove ernment will help us forward in the right direction

Taxation must stay high as long as Gay- ernment insiste qt spending at a level vastly above 1913 · Can it be necessary to spend on the Government supervision of Mercau- tile Marine about four times more than in 1918, or £14,000,000 more on Civil Ser vice pay in 1923 than 10131 Would it mor be better to reduce the work rather than burden industry with these heavy addi tional expus!.

Describing how the fall of the mark, had enabled the German shipowner and export- er to undercut foreign competitors, be said. that the Chamber estimates that on wages of crews alone the German Mercantile Marine last year saved £4,400,000.

Luckily for the tale of the world. the debauch of inflation cannot continue indg-

nitely.

It is no small refief to German trade that by the disappearance of the mark every business is cleared of its debta,

Great Britain, we are assured by our banker, has not lost, ground in 1923; money is being saved, issues of new capital are being rapidly absorbed, and London is again taking its place as the best market. for foreign loans.

AMBASSADOR'S - TRIBUTE TO THE ENGLISH GENTLEMAN.

on

17

Senor Don Merry del Val, the 'Spanish Ambassador in London, in thanking Dr. A R. Pastor, who delivered an address at King's Collego

Spain and Europe," said that the Spanish idea of the gentleman had grown with the course of time; and, curiously enough, in no country in the world had it been given, greater or better expression than England. Everyone now looked to Eng- land for the type which was called "gen.. tleman," · There was'a very simple rentou for this. It was because in England alone had it been prasically realised that the education of will and of character was more fundamentally important than the mer cramming of knowledge into the hends of the young.
